This short-story is inspired from the human-hunt themed Gary Busey film "Surviving the Game" [1994] and from the X-Men: The Animated Series (Fox TV) episode Reunion [1994].

=====

Gambit, Mister Fantastic, and Elektra find themselves stranded on a seemingly deserted island after their plane crashes during a jet-combat with Magneto. After they find they are alone on the island, they begin to forage for food and build a shelter and find ways to signal civilization for help. Mister Fantastic starts building a fire-signal plan to hail any passing aircraft in the area, Gambit looks for food, and Elektra starts building a hut on the shore.

Unknown to them, the island is inhabited by Ruckus and Count Vertigo. They intend to disarm the three heroes with their powers of disorientation and then keep them as hostages. Ruckus says to Count Vertigo, "I say we make a devilish game out of this," to which Count Vertigo replies, "You send your shocking sound-waves to send them running towards me, and I will knock them unconscious with this tree-branch trap." The two go ahead and put their scheme in motion.

The hut is built and Mister Fantastic has his campfire signal ready for night-time use. The next day, the three heroes go wandering around the island, just to make sure there are no other inhabitants. They are roaming around when suddenly they see Ruckus running towards them. He sends his devastating vocal-cord screams, and the three heroes begin running away from him. Then, they see Count Vertigo but it's too late --- he uses his gift to trap them in a tree-branch matrix. That night, the three awake to find themselves tied up with some kind of strong layered natural rope made out of tree-threads. Ruckus and Count Vertigo are standing over them.

Count Vertigo says to the three heroes, "We've been stranded on this island now for about six months. We've seen no rescue ships, so we've grown accustomed to the idea that we may never be able to leave. Our powers are weakened here (for some unknown reason), and we can't swim (so forget that escape plan). This means you three can't swim either. Mister Fantastic replies, "Yes, I've noticed diminished powers too. You have no idea why this is happening?" to which Count Vertigo says, "No. Maybe we're in the Bermuda Triangle. In any case, Ruckus and I have decided to continue playing our human hunting game with you. Every morning, we'll chase you around the island. It will pass the time!"

Mister Fantastic says to Ruckus and Count Vertigo, "Don't be deranged. We can't just spend our lives here playing your human hunting game. We have to find a way off this island and we have to find out why our powers are diminished.

Nearby, Dark Phoenix has been watching the five of them. It was she who planned that these five find themselves on this deserted island, and it was she who drained their powers. She now intends to use them in a great ransom scheme with Professor Xavier. She sends a communique to Xavier: "I have five individuals in my custody, with their strength diminished on a deserted island. If you wish to rescue them, you must come here and sacrifice Gambit. He is mine."
